حَدَّثَنَا عَبِيدَةُ بْنُ حُمَيْدٍ، عَنْ يَزِيدَ بْنِ أَبِي زِيَادٍ، عَنْ مُجَاهِدٍ، عَنْ أَسْمَاءَ بِنْتِ أَبِي بَكْرٍ، قَالَتْ: " حَجَجْنَا مَعَ رَسُولِ اللهِ صَلَّى الله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، فَأَمَرَنَا، فَجَعَلْنَاهَا عُمْرَةً، فَأَحْلَلْنَا كُلَّ الْإِحْلَالِ (٢) ، حَتَّى سَطَعَتْ الْمَجَامِرُ بَيْنَ النِّسَاءِ وَالرِّجَالِ " (٣)،

Translation

English translation

It is narrated from Asma that we set out with the intention of Hajj along with the Prophet (peace be upon him). The Prophet (peace be upon him) commanded us, so we made it the Ihram of Umrah, and all things became lawful for us as before, to the extent that even braziers were kindled between women and men.
